Sports and Games and Great Campaigns is the third joint exhibition by Manfred Schotten and Christopher Clarke Antiques. Both businesses are known for their expertise in their field. Manfred for his knowledge of sporting antiques and the Clarke brothers for theirs in campaign furniture. This exhibition brings together the best of both worlds and shows how easily the two sit together.

Britain’s rivers have been the source of both life and pleasure to many people over the centuries. From the ghillie who earns a living from his knowledge of the local waters to the gentleman who relaxes by fishing on them; from the university crew rowing for glory to the lock keeper who watches the waters rise and fall; all are part of Britain’s river life. Still waters run deep will illustrate this rich heritage with pictures, silver, ceramics and equipment associated with the river from the 18th, 19th and early 20th Century.
